What are the primary conclusions of IFIs research report (IFI RR-2) to determine if pitch diameter size has influence on fastener performance?

Study conclusions were as follows; 1.System 21 thread gaging demonstrated the detection of out-of-tolerance pitch diameters in all test lots as well as System 22 gaging. 2.For aerospace nuts, pitch diameter size had no bearing on the fastener’s tensile strength performance.
